We know that readers of this fine blog want to know about Syracuse Orange sports, but it’s not every summer that a former Heisman Trophy winner will be spending his summer in the 315. With Tim Tebow in town to play for the Syracuse Mets, it’s going to provide some media attention.
Even though Syracuse embarrassed Tebow’s alma mater so badly in 1991 that the Florida Gators have refused to travel north again, we still want to see Tim enjoy his stay in our fine city and we want to help our fellow media colleagues track his movements.
